Browse Library →Description
In order to get back at his annoying roommate, Zhu Shizhou, Bai Zining deliberately created a fake account pretending to be a girl and started an online relationship with him.
At first, Zhu Shizhou was indifferent, often taking days to reply to a single message. However, one day, Bai Zining sent him a photo of his legs, and Zhu Shizhou’s attitude suddenly turned enthusiastic. The two quickly fell into a passionate online romance.
Two months later, Zhu Shizhou proposed meeting in person, which terrified Bai Zining. To avoid being exposed, Bai Zining began acting out, making unreasonable demands in the hope Zhu Shizhou would break up with him. Yet, Zhu Shizhou not only didn’t get upset but fulfilled every request one by one.
Caught in his own trap, Bai Zining couldn’t find a way out. Then one day, while the dorm was empty, he decided to wear a skirt and take pictures to send to Zhu Shizhou. Just as he was getting ready, Zhu Shizhou walked into the dorm and opened the door.
Pairing: Scheming top × Petty, clueless bottom
Tags: Sweet Story, Campus Life, Lighthearted
Additional Themes: Online romance, identity reveal, dorm drama.

## My Thoughts on *Who Says Online Dating Never Ends Well?*
This novel promised a fluffy, quick read, and for the most part, it delivered. As someone who enjoys a lighthearted danmei, I decided to give *Who Says Online Dating Never Ends Well?* a shot, and I found myself charmed by its simplicity, though not entirely without reservations.
### First Impressions
The premise is classic: misunderstandings, revenge plots that backfire spectacularly, and a dash of online catfishing. Our MC, fueled by perceived slights from the ML, decides to enact his revenge by pretending to be a girl online and seducing him. Predictably, things don't go according to plan. It's a setup ripe for comedic moments and heartwarming confessions.
### What Works Well
I especially loved the dynamic between the MC and ML. The author really shines in portraying the MC's internal struggle as he falls for the ML despite his initial intentions. The story does a good job of showing us how the MC genuinely develops feelings, which makes the romance feel earned, even within the short timeframe. The ML is also quite endearing, and his caring nature shines through, making it easy to root for their relationship. It's easy to become invested in this couple, and there's an undeniable adorableness to their interactions.
### Areas of Concern
While the novel is enjoyable, its brevity is also its downfall. The plot moves at a rapid pace, and the character development, while present, feels somewhat rushed. I found myself wishing for a bit more depth and exploration of their relationship after the initial conflict resolves. I also felt that the MC's "revenge" plot was a bit thin, and the initial misunderstandings could have been fleshed out more to create a more compelling foundation for the story.
### ⚠️ Spoiler Warning
Okay, I'm going to dance around this carefully. Knowing that the MC is essentially tricking the ML from the start might make some readers uncomfortable. However, the ML's reaction to the reveal and the subsequent development of their relationship is handled well enough that it didn't bother me too much.
### Final Verdict
*Who Says Online Dating Never Ends Well?* is a charming, if somewhat lightweight, danmei that's perfect for a quick and fluffy read. If you're looking for a deep and complex story, this might not be for you. However, if you're in the mood for something sweet, adorable, and relatively drama-free, I'd recommend giving it a try. I'd rate it a solid 4 out of 5 stars. It's a delightful little treat that left me with a smile, even if I wished there was just a little more to savor.
